Background

IL20RB belongs to the type II cytokine receptor family. There are two kinds of type II cytokine receptors: cytokine receptors that bind type I and type II interferons; cytokine receptors that bind members of the interleukin-10 family (interleukin-10, interleukin-20, and interleukin-22) . Type II cytokine receptors are similar to type I cytokine receptors except they do not possess the signature sequence WSXWS that is characteristic of type I receptors. They are expressed on the surface of certain cells, which bind and respond to a select group of cytokines. These receptors are related predominantly by sequence similarities in their extracellular portions that are composed of tandem Ig-like domains. The intracellular domain of type II cytokine receptors is typically associated with a tyrosine kinase belonging to the Janus kinase (JAK) family. IL20RB and IL20RA form a heterodimeric receptor for interleukin-20.

Overview

A DNA sequence encoding the cynomolgus IL20RB (XP_005545913.1) (Asp30-Ala230) was expressed with the Fc region of human IgG1 at the C-terminus.
